Illini Drop 18 Strokes; Finish 11th

April 9, 2000

BLOOMINGTON, Ind. - The Illini shot a 329 today, 18 strokes better than the 347 they shot Saturday, to take 11th place in the 15-team Indiana Invitational. Illinois was tied with Northern Illinois for 13th place after the opening round of the tournament. The event, which is held at the 74-par, 6,134 yard Indiana University Golf Course, was scheduled to have three rounds, but it was shortened to two rounds because of the weather.

Freshmen continued to lead the Illinois squad. Renata Young paced the Illini. She shot an 82 today to tie for 30th with a three-round total of 166 strokes. Two other freshmen, Stephanie Cheney and Laurin Kanda, tied for 33rd place. Cheney shot a 79 today to finish with 167. Kanda shot an 82 to finish with 167 also.

The Illinois women's golf team will host the annual Illini Classic next Saturday and Sunday, April 15-16, at Stone Creek Golf Club in Urbana. The event is slated to begin with a 9 a.m. shotgun start both days.
